      Step One:

      Determining your body type.

      For most accurate results use a sewing measuring tape to measure the width of the following areas:

       

      • The widest part of your SHOULDERS
      • The fullest part of your BUST
      • The smallest part of your WAIST
      • The widest part of your HIPS

      Select Your Body Type

      Round

      Bust measurement is often the largest.

      Larger bust, narrow hips, and a full midsection. 

      triangle

      Hips measure larger than shoulders and bust.

      Weight tends to carry in the hips, thighs and butt. 

      Inverted Triangle

      Shoulders and bust measure wider than hips.

      Rectangle

      Near equal bust, waist, and hip measurements.

      The lack of curves appears like a rectangle.

      Hourglass

      Hips and bust are nearly equal in size, with a much smaller waist measurement.
